Your serpentine belt powers critical systems like the alternator, power steering, and AC compressor. Warning signs like squealing noises, accessory failures, or visible cracks mean immediate attention is needed. Louisiana's heat and humidity accelerate belt wear, making regular inspections essential. Trust our team for accurate diagnostics, proper installations, and maintenance to extend belt life.

Serpentine Belt Insights
Recognizing Belt Problems
Listen for squealing or chirping sounds, especially when starting or turning. Check for cracks, fraying, or glazing on the belt surface.
Replacement Intervals
Most belts need replacement every 60,000-100,000 miles. We recommend inspections every 30,000 miles in our climate.
Complete System Service
We inspect all pulleys, tensioners, and alignment during belt replacements to prevent rapid wear.
Proper Tension Matters
Over-tightened belts strain bearings, while loose belts slip. We use laser tension gauges for perfect adjustment.
